Another fine DVD captures the 15th concert (8th of 13 @ Ronnie Scott’s London) performed by the Notting Hillbillies at the end of July through to August 1st in 1998. Entering their second week of their residency at the venue, they were, performing their set like a well-oiled machine by this stage. Pity we couldn’t say the same about Brendan’s throat this night. He had “lost his voice”, so Mark had to sing ‘Feel like going home’. Plenty of nice moments throughout with Mark’s, -playing during guitar solos really blossoming. A great example is the fantastic extended adlib, outro to ‘Calling Elvis’.
The Notting Hillbillies Concert: #15 of 20, 1998 tour
Venue: Ronnie Scott’s in London www.ronniescotts.co.uk/
en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ronnie_S...
Date: Monday, 27 July 1998
Length: 2:19:53
